Wayne is appointed to the Board of REH as a nominee of Triandra Limited (“Triandra”) which recently, under advice from its investment adviser Consensus Business Group Limited ("Consensus"), exercised warrants to subscribe for 4,000,000 new ordinary shares of 1 pence each in the capital of the Company at a price of 50 pence per share. This warrant exercise was announced on 13 August 2007.
Wayne Bruce Keast, aged 37, is Chief Executive of Consensus Environment, the £250m CleanTech and Environmental private equity and strategic investment arm of Consensus. Wayne is also an investment director for the US$250m Masdar CleanTech Fund and the US$150m Inspired Evolution Environmental Fund. He is on the advisory boards / strategic committees for Aloe Environment Fund II, Chrysalix Energy II LP and Expansion Capital Clean Tech Fund II. Wayne is also a non-executive director of a number of public and private companies operating in the bio-fuel, clean energy / technology, carbon and waste recycling sectors.
Prior to joining Consensus, Wayne spent several years in corporate finance, venture capital and private equity positions, including a number of years as chief financial officer at ePartners and eVentures, the $1.2 billion global private equity and business incubation group.
Wayne is a qualified Chartered Accountant with a Bachelors and Honours degree in Commerce & Finance.

About Renewable Energy Holdings
Renewable Energy Holdings is an international company established to be an operator of, and undertake active investment in, both proven and innovative renewable energy technologies.
REH owns two wind farm sites in Germany: Kesfeld, a 32.5MW wind farm, and Kirf, a 8MW wind farm. In addition, REH is at various stages of development of further wind farm sites in Poland, Hungary and Wales.
REH owns a 1MW methane Landfill Gas Project in Powys, Wales. The long-term objective for this project is to increase production to 5-6MW.
CETO is REH’s innovative wave power technology. It is the first wave power converter to sit on the seabed, where it is invisible, safe from storms and ocean forces, and self contained. Unlike other wave energy technologies that require undersea grids and costly marine qualified plant, CETO requires only a small diameter pipe to carry high pressure seawater ashore to either a turbine to produce electricity, or to a reverse osmosis filter to produce fresh water.
In April 2007, REH secured a credit facility with Standard Chartered Bank of up to €135,000,000 (c. £91.8m).
In July 2007, REH entered into a binding Memorandum of Understanding with EDF Energies Nouvelles SA (EDF EN) regarding a Collaboration Agreement which will exclusively permit EDF EN to develop offshore wave power projects in the Northern Hemisphere and at Reunion Island in the Indian Ocean using REH’s proprietary CETO wave power technology.
The Directors and executive team of REH have extensive experience in both the conventional and renewable energy sectors, both in the UK and overseas, and through their experience have built a broad international network of relationships with individuals, companies, governments and lobby groups.
The Company was incorporated in the Isle of Man on 8 October 2004 and listed on the London Stock Exchange’s AIM Market in February 2005.
